Clackety Track: Poems about Trains

por Skila Brown

Queue up for a whistle-stop tour of trains of all kinds, narrated in lively verse and featuring dynamic retro artwork. Rows of grooves, cables, and bars. Graffiti rockin' out the cars. A badge of rust. A proud oil stain.There's nothin' plain about a train. All aboard!

This is a collection of poems about different types of trains. I used to like trains when I was a kid but I did not know how many types of trains there were. This book lists over a dozen kinds of trains, one of them being a Shoulder Ballast Cleaner which I think most people haven'd heard of. I like that it tells about trains that are not common knowledge. I think a lot of kids find trains interesting and I think it can boost a child's confidence when they know things that are not common knowledge to others. This book also had a lot of rhyming words so it was fun to read out loud. In the back of the book there is a picture of a train and each train car has a fact about a different type of train and its history. Overall I think this book is very informational while keeping the story upbeat and interesting to read. ( )

I don't really have a ton to say about this book. The book is extremely straight forward. There are 13 poems total, 1 per page. The title is some kind of adjective, followed by the word train. Every poem is about the train in the title. These poems are super simple and cute and describe the different trains in a fun way. I think if whoever is reading this book is a train lover, they will adore this book. I really liked poem 11, "Shoulder Ballast Cleaner", because the whole poem was written on different parts of the train illustration. I also loved that the last page is filled with train facts. ( )

Clackety Track is a book full of poems about trains. It would be great to use when doing a unit on trains. There are many different types of poems in the book that can be used as examples to show students there are different ways to write poems. The pictures are also a good demonstration of what the poem is about. At the end of the book there are a bunch of facts that relate to trains. This would be good to use when you are trying to teach students about poetry, trains and transportation. It's a good way to expose them to a variety of different things all at once! ( )
